Snapshot View Of The Canadian Teams At The Deadline

from a team of writers at the Globe and Mail,

VANCOUVER CANUCKS

Needs A defensive forward. The Vancouver Canucks are having success with former checkers Ryan Kesler and Alex Burrows on the top two lines, and a shut-down centre would ensure they stayed there. A versatile bottom-six forward would bolster depth, push incumbents and give head coach Alain Vigneault line-matching options. Longer term, four of Vancouver’s top six forwards are unrestricted free agents this summer (Mats Sundin, Daniel Sedin, Henrik Sedin and Burrows).

Tradable commodities Left winger Mason Raymond, a young speedster who hasn’t taken advantage of opportunities this season, is on a cheap contract and has potential. Disappointing winger Taylor Pyatt is also available.
